优化选择:亚马逊AWS云服务器配置策略
结论:选择亚马逊AWS云服务器的配置并非一成不变,而是需要根据业务需求、预算和预期增长进行灵活调整。理想配置应具备足够的计算能力、存储空间、内存和网络带宽,同时兼顾成本效益和扩展性。在实践中,我们发现以下几点是决定配置的关键因素。
首先,计算能力。如果你的业务涉及大量数据处理或高并发操作,那么强大的CPU性能是必不可少的。例如,Amazon EC2的M系列或C系列实例提供了高性能的计算资源。对于轻量级应用,T系列实例则是一个经济实惠的选择。
其次,存储需求。这取决于你的数据量和访问频率。S3适用于大规模、低访问频率的数据存储,而EBS则更适合需要频繁读写操作的应用。如果业务对IOPS(每秒输入/输出操作)有高要求,可以选择Provisioned IOPS SSD。
再者,内存大小。内存是影响应用性能的关键因素,尤其是对于运行数据库或其他内存密集型应用的服务器。R系列实例提供大内存,适合内存缓存和大数据分析。
网络带宽也是不容忽视的一环。如果你的业务需要处理大量网络流量,如视频流或游戏服务,选择具备高网络性能的实例类型,如H系列,能确保数据传输的顺畅。
成本控制是另一个重要考虑因素。AWS提供了多种计费模式,如按需付费、预留实例和竞价实例等。对于稳定的业务,预付费可以节省成本;对于波动性大的业务,按需付费更灵活。此外,利用AWS的成本管理工具,如成本探索器,可以帮助监控和优化支出。
最后,考虑到业务的未来发展,选择可扩展的配置至关重要。AWS的弹性伸缩服务可以根据业务需求自动调整资源,避免了因预估不足导致的资源浪费或不足。
总的来说,选择亚马逊AWS云服务器的配置是一项综合考量工作,需要平衡性能、存储、内存、网络、成本和扩展性。理解并分析你的业务需求,才能做出最合适的决策。在实践中,定期评估和调整配置也是必要的,以适应业务的变化和发展。
CLOUD知识